Winter Snow Party (indoors) Put white sheets completely over your kitchen/dining table . This is the igloo -welcoming area for your guests. If you want to be dramatic, put quilt batting on the floor under the table so the guests in the igloo will be cushioned.  As guests arrive, lead them to the igloo (holding area). When all the guests have arrived, everyone comes out of the igloo.  With white felt or if you're a knitter you can make stuffed felt or knitted "snow balls".  They are so fluffy that they don't damage furniture (but maybe hide the figurines). The guests can have a snowball fight.  Also there is a game of tossing all the snowballs into the  air and seeing who can catch the most snowballs on the way down. Next, give each guest a drinking straw and a paper cut-out snowflake.  Mark one line on one end of the room and another at the other end because we're having a "snowflake race". The participants have to blow, with the straw, their snowflake from one point to the other. The second part of this game is to suck with the straw and carry the paper snowflake back to the starting line. Another game is to split the group into two teams. We're playing "snowball hockey". You need a cotton ball and the kitchen table (with the igloo cloth now removed).  The teams have to hold hands and only with their breath (no hands or arms or feet etc.) do they strive to keep the cotton ball on the table at their end. The object of the game is to blow the cotton ball off the opponent's side of the table thus scoring a goal.  The table can be officially marked with a piece of tape.  Snack:  Dried Apple Ring Necklaces (elastic string) Food: "Blizzard Pizza" essentially a Mozzarella & sauce pizza. Cake:  ...you guessed it, Snowball Cake (white cake with jam center and white icing with either White chocolate shavings or coconut shavings)  Another game is "melt the ice cube" the object is to melt the ice cube first. Rule: you may not put it in your mouth.  You can breathe on it, sit on it, hold it in your hands etc. Note: have towels ready for the cold wet hands.  Goody bags: The knitted or felt snowball. Dried apple ring necklace. Paper snowflakes
